Orthotonic is an adjective.
The adjective is the word that accompanies the noun to determine or qualify it.

WHAT DOES ORTHOTONIC M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Definition of orthotonic in the English dictionary

The definition of orthotonic in the dictionary is characterized by muscular rigidity.
